Twenty-eight<a href="https://www.pulse.com.gh/news/local/immigration-officers-arrest-5-togolese-for-acquiring-ghana-voter-id/5ecmltd"> foreign nationals</a> have been arrested for entering the country through an unapproved route at Hamile in the Lambussie District of the Upper West Region.
Advertisement
The illegal entrants were arrested on Wednesday, July 22, 2020.
Advertisement
The regional command of the Ghana Immigration Service (GIS) said the migrants who are all Burkina Faso nationals aged between 3 and 64 were arrested and they are made up of 19 males and 9 females.
Burkinabes arrested
They have since been handed over to the Burkina Faso authorities on the other side of the border at the Hamile post.
